Your cheapest option for sure is a PFC (second hand on here or eBay). Then get it fitted and mapped by Jolly Green Monster (he can travel to you). JGM also can supply, fit and map a brand new PFC, should you wish. However...

...If you were considering a brand new PFC, then in mine, and I'm sure JGM's opinion, the Simtek is the superior option. JGM can supply a brand new one, fit and map it for not too much more than the PFC - see here: www.jollygreenmonster.co.uk

The Simtek, amongst other features, runs MAFless (very much a good thing!) and you can have two genuinely separate, switchable maps on it. For example, one map could be for normal 97 RON; the other for V-Power 99 (or, say, V-Power + a 20% E85 mix), etc...
